How Root Planing Works and Why It’s Important?
Root planing is a dental treatment focused on cleaning the roots of your teeth below the gum line. Unlike standard dental scaling that only removes plaque and tartar above the gums, root planing reaches deeper areas where harmful bacteria accumulate.
This treatment helps your gums reattach to the teeth and supports healing. By eliminating bacteria and smoothing the root surfaces, root planing makes it harder for plaque to build up again, reducing the risk of worsening gum disease.
Relationship with Deep Cleaning
Root planing is a key component of a deep cleaning. Deep cleaning is recommended when gum disease has caused deep pockets between teeth and gums. These pockets trap bacteria that regular cleaning cannot reach.
Signs you might need a deep cleaning include:
Bleeding or swollen gums
Persistent bad breath
Loose teeth
Deep gum pockets
How Does Root Planing Work?
During root planing, your dentist will carefully remove tartar, bacteria, and damaged tissue from the roots of your teeth. The process smooths the root surfaces, which encourages the gum tissue to heal and reattach to your teeth.
Step-by-step process:
Assessment: Your dentist examines your gums and measures pocket depths.
Local anaesthesia: To minimise discomfort, local anaesthetic is applied.
Scaling: Plaque and tartar are removed from above and below the gum line.
Planing: Roots are smoothed to remove rough areas where bacteria cling.
Post-treatment care: Instructions for brushing, flossing, and mouth rinses are provided.
Why Root Planing is Important for Gum Health
Reducing Gum Inflammation
Root planing removes calculus and plaque that irritate gums. Smoothing the roots makes it harder for bacteria to accumulate, which helps gums reattach and reduces pocket depths.
After treatment, patients often notice:
Less bleeding while brushing
Firmer and pinker gums
Reduced swelling and discomfort
Reducing the Risk of Severe Gum Disease
Untreated gum disease can progress to severe problems:
Gum recession
Bone loss around teeth
Loose teeth or tooth loss
Chronic bad breath
By addressing gum disease early with root planing, you can prevent these complications and maintain a healthier smile.
Oral Health and Overall Health
Gum disease is linked to broader health risks, including:
Heart disease and stroke
Diabetes complications
Respiratory infections
Bacteria from infected gums can enter the bloodstream, increasing inflammation in other parts of the body. Root planing helps control these bacteria and supports overall health.
Root Planing Cost in Singapore
The cost of root planing varies depending on the clinic, severity of gum disease, and additional treatments needed.
Typical pricing:
$160 to $600 per quadrant
$30 to $50 per tooth
Some clinics may charge up to $700 per quadrant
Factors influencing cost:
Clinic type: Specialist or private practices may charge more.
Severity of gum disease: Deeper pockets require more extensive treatment.
Additional treatments: Scaling, polishing, medication, or consultation fees.

Day-to-Day Care After Root Planing
Maintaining your gums after root planing involves consistent oral hygiene:
Brush twice daily with a soft-bristle toothbrush
Floss daily to remove plaque between teeth
Use antimicrobial mouth rinses if recommended
Attend regular dental check-ups and scaling sessions
Avoid smoking, which can delay healing
Following these steps helps your gums reattach and prevents new pockets from forming.

FAQs About Root Planing
What is root planing in dentistry?
Root planing is a deep cleaning procedure that removes tartar and bacteria from tooth roots below the gum line to treat gum disease.
How is root planing different from dental scaling?
Scaling removes plaque and tartar above the gum line, while root planing cleans the roots below the gum line and smooths them to prevent bacteria buildup.
Is root planing painful?
Local anaesthesia is used, so most patients experience minimal discomfort during the procedure.
How long does it take to recover?
Mild soreness or gum sensitivity may last a few days. Healing is supported by proper oral hygiene.
How often should I get root planing?
Frequency depends on your gum health. Your dentist may recommend every 4 to 6 months if you have persistent gum disease.
Can root planing prevent tooth loss?
Yes. By reducing gum inflammation and shrinking periodontal pockets, root planing protects the supporting structures of your teeth.
